Chemical producers, Europe
The core of the field and the segment where a feedstock decision is a capital decision. Large enough to fund independent work, and slow enough that an outside read has to arrive before the business case is written rather than after it.
Who signs: head of sustainability, VP of innovation or R&D director, feedstock and raw materials procurement lead, corporate strategy.
27,000 to 30,000
companies registered across the European chemical industry; roughly 1,400 of them carry 250 or more people
Plastics converters and compounders
Downstream of the producers and closer to the deadline, because recycled content and packaging rules land on the finished article rather than on the molecule. Numerous, fragmented, and mostly without anyone inside who reads the policy.
Who signs: technical director, head of materials, sustainability manager, product development lead.
45,000 to 55,000
converting and compounding companies across Europe; the layer above 250 people is roughly 900 to 1,200
Consumer brand owners under packaging rules
Food, drink, personal care and household. They do not make the material and they carry the obligation anyway, which is why they buy the read rather than build it. The segment most likely to fund a study it can quote publicly.
Who signs: head of packaging development, sustainability director, materials procurement lead, corporate affairs.
3,500 to 4,500
European manufacturers in these categories at 250 people or more; the wider registered population runs into the tens of thousands
Pulp, paper and man-made fibers
Small by company count and unusually concentrated, so one relationship reaches a large share of the segment. Also the segment where bio-based is the incumbent rather than the alternative, which changes the question they are asking.
Who signs: technical director, head of innovation, business unit or mill manager.
850 to 950
mills across Europe, operated by roughly 450 to 550 companies
Recycling and waste operators
Wide at the base and narrow at the top. Mechanical recycling is a large and mature population, while the chemical recycling layer, the part that touches renewable carbon directly, is a named list rather than a market.
Who signs: chief technology officer, head of business development, plant or project director.
25,000 to 30,000
registered waste and recycling companies across Europe; the chemical recycling layer inside that sits in the low hundreds
Investors and project developers
The buyer type that funds the transition rather than performs it, and the one that pays for independent market data most readily, because a diligence deadline is a hard date. Worth being straight about a limit: this group is not enumerated at usable resolution anywhere public.
Who signs: investment director, partner, head of corporate venturing, technical diligence lead.
No usable public register
identified one at a time by mandate and by portfolio; the difficulty is the reason the segment stays open

Where the openings are

1
The seat that buys this work is new, and it has a name. Head of renewable carbon. Defossilization lead. Circular materials manager. Titles that barely existed five years ago now hold the budget, and they are filled by people who have not yet appeared on any conference list. A reputation channel reaches whoever already reads the field. A named-role channel reaches the seat in the month it is filled.
2
Two buyers, two budgets, and they do not refer each other. The person who buys market data sits in strategy or market intelligence. The person who commissions accompanying research and consulting sits in innovation or R&D. Same company, different door, and a reputation-led channel tends to keep arriving at whichever door answered first.
3
A conference reaches the converted. It is the strongest asset in this field and the narrowest by definition, because a company that sends someone is a company that already agrees. The band that stays unreached is the mid-size producer with a regulatory deadline and nobody inside to read the field for them.
4
Regulation is the clock, and the clock is public. Packaging and single-use rules, recycled content mandates, corporate sustainability reporting. Those dates land on named companies. Watching several thousand of them for the moment a deadline turns into a budget line is mechanical work, and it is exactly the part that a publication and a conference cannot do.
